Why You Should Hire an Asbestos Attorney

Asbestos is the cause of many cancers. This includes mesothelioma, lung cancer and asbestosis. Many victims are entitled to compensation from negligent companies.

Victims can be compensated through personal injury or wrongful-death lawsuits as well as trust funds and VA benefits. yonkers mesothelioma attorney lawyers can help victims and families get the financial compensation that they are entitled to. The compensation can aid victims in paying for medical bills and funeral costs, lost wages and other expenses incurred by the disease.

Asbestos attorneys may also file a lawsuit against asbestos companies responsible for the exposure. In the event of a lawsuit, damages could be demanded for both past and future losses. The value of a lawsuit is determined by the both the economic and non-economic losses that the victim has suffered. Economic damages can include medical bills and lost income, while non-economic damages include suffering and pain.

Trust funds for asbestos can offer compensation to asbestos victims. Trusts were created as part of bankruptcy settlements with asbestos companies. Lawyers can assist victims in filing a claim against the trust fund and then submitting it to asbestos companies for a review.

Trust funds may aid victims in paying medical bills, travel expenses as well as loss of earnings, and other expenses related to mesothelioma treatment. Asbestos patients may also be entitled to disability compensation from the Veteran's Administration. Veterans can avail VA benefits with the help of lawyers.

A wrongful death suit can be filed on behalf of a deceased mesothelioma victim by the family members or estate representatives. These lawsuits are used to bring asbestos companies to account and to seek compensation for the victim's loved relatives. The amount of compensation offered will be determined by the degree of the illness and the extent of their exposure to asbestos-containing products. In addition, wrongful death lawsuits may include restitution for funeral expenses, loss of consortium and the victim's suffering and pain. In general, mesothelioma lawsuits settle for between $1 million and $1.4 million. However, jury verdicts could be more than $10 million in some instances.
